Design Engineering is a magazine for mechanical engineers, machine builders, product developers, industrial designers and related professionals practicing in Canada. Canada’s leading engineering design publication, Design Engineering has been in continuous publication since 1955. This national magazine fosters innovation by providing cutting-edge coverage on a broad range of engineering topics including MCAD, PLM, fluid power, motion control, rapid prototyping, materials, electronics and all products relevant to the machine builders and product developers.

The monthly Believer’s Magazine has been published continuously since 1891, and its purpose has not changed in that time. Accurate exposition and relevant application of Bible truth lie at its core. Practical, devotional, apologetic and prophetic teaching combines with book reviews, accounts of missionary endeavour, and articles about Christian history, to provide a highly readable and informative magazine

The powerful and riveting new book in the multimillion-selling Killing series by Bill OReilly and Martin Dugard. Autumn 1944. World War II is nearly over in Europe but is escalating in the Pacific, where American soldiers face an opponent who will go to any length to avoid defeat. The Japanese army follows the samurai code of Bushido, stipulating that surrender is a form of dishonor. Killing the Rising Sun takes readers to the bloody tropical-island battlefields of Peleliu and Iwo Jima and to the embattled Philippines, where General Douglas MacArthur has made a triumphant return and is plotting a full-scale invasion of Japan.
